Approaches That Guide Online Care

Attachment-Based Therapy focuses on patterns of connection and trust formed in close relationships. It helps clients understand how past bonds influence current feelings and behaviors, and supports healing in areas such as intimacy, attachment issues, and family dynamics.

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) helps people identify unhelpful thoughts and habits and replace them with more effective ways of thinking and acting. It is often used for stress, anxiety, depression, and coping with life changes because it emphasizes practical strategies and measurable progress.

Client-Centered Therapy emphasizes a respectful, nonjudgmental therapeutic relationship where the clientâs perspective leads the work. This approach can be especially helpful for building self-esteem, clarifying goals, and feeling accepted while exploring difficult choices.
